Transaction 59ff362dbb759f41e5bfa7272834dc58dd635d190fa30533a8bb0ef8a6e85cf6

1 Input
2 Outputs
  • 59ff362dbb759f41e5bfa7272834dc58dd635d190fa30533a8bb0ef8a6e85cf6:0
  • value  439620
    address  38VnzpNSr3ywyYLJXxf1BBwx3dHbCKwDm7
  • 59ff362dbb759f41e5bfa7272834dc58dd635d190fa30533a8bb0ef8a6e85cf6:1
  • value  556624
    address  3PmSTuUr8yHReeZRnSPxFm1So9GNRpBM7x